Cy5 amine (non-sulfonated)
Cy5 amine is a reactive dye which contains amino group. This dye can be coupled with a variety of activated esters and other electrophilic reagents. For instance, this amine can be coupled with EDC-activated carboxylic groups. With this bright and photostable reagent, many different methods of fluorescence detection is available and colorful fluorophore can also be easily detected in small quantities by naked human eye. For biomolecule labeling, using of organic co-solvent to dissolve this molecular is necessary for efficient reaction. First, Cyanine dye should be dissolved in organic solvent and then added to a solution of biomolecule in appropriate aqueous buffer.

Physical Appearance | A solid |
Storage | Store at -20°C |
M.Wt | 653.77 |
Formula | C38H54Cl2N4O |
Solubility | ≥48 mg/mL in DMSO; insoluble in H2O; ≥8.84 mg/mL in EtOH |
Chemical Name | 1-(6-((6-ammoniohexyl)amino)-6-oxohexyl)-3,3-dimethyl-2-((1E,3E,5E)-5-(1,3,3-trimethylindolin-2-ylidene)penta-1,3-dien-1-yl)-3H-indol-1-ium |

Excitation max (nm) | 646 | Emission max (nm) | 662 |
Extinction Coefficient (M-1cm-1) | 250000 | Quantum Yield | 0.2 |
CF260 | 0.03 | CF280 | 0.04 |
